NAME
gnutls_privkey_sign_hash - API function SYNOPSIS
#include <gnutls/abstract.h> int gnutls_privkey_sign_hash(gnutls_privkey_t signer, gnutls_digest_algorithm_t hash_algo, unsigned int flags, const gnutls_datum_t * hash_data, gnutls_datum_t * signature); ARGUMENTS
gnutls_privkey_t signer Holds the signer's key gnutls_digest_algorithm_t hash_algo The hash algorithm used unsigned int flags Zero or one of gnutls_privkey_flags_t const gnutls_datum_t * hash_data holds the data to be signed gnutls_datum_t * signature will contain newly allocated signature DESCRIPTION
This function will sign the given hashed data using a signature algorithm supported by the private key. Signature algorithms are always used together with a hash functions. Different hash functions may be used for the RSA algorithm, but only SHA-XXX for the DSA keys. You may use gnutls_pubkey_get_preferred_hash_algorithm() to determine the hash algorithm. Note that if GNUTLS_PRIVKEY_SIGN_FLAG_TLS1_RSA flag is specified this function will ignore hash_algo and perform a raw PKCS1 signature. RETURNS
On success, GNUTLS_E_SUCCESS (0) is returned, otherwise a negative error value. SINCE

NAME
gnutls_x509_privkey_import_rsa_raw2 - API function SYNOPSIS
#include <gnutls/x509.h> int gnutls_x509_privkey_import_rsa_raw2(gnutls_x509_privkey_t key, const gnutls_datum_t * m, const gnutls_datum_t * e, const gnutls_datum_t * d, const gnutls_datum_t * p, const gnutls_datum_t * q, const gnutls_datum_t * u, const gnutls_datum_t * e1, const gnutls_datum_t * e2); ARGUMENTS
gnutls_x509_privkey_t key The structure to store the parsed key const gnutls_datum_t * m holds the modulus const gnutls_datum_t * e holds the public exponent const gnutls_datum_t * d holds the private exponent const gnutls_datum_t * p holds the first prime (p) const gnutls_datum_t * q holds the second prime (q) const gnutls_datum_t * u holds the coefficient const gnutls_datum_t * e1 holds e1 = d mod (p-1) const gnutls_datum_t * e2 holds e2 = d mod (q-1) DESCRIPTION
This function will convert the given RSA raw parameters to the native gnutls_x509_privkey_t format. The output will be stored in key . RETURNS
On success, GNUTLS_E_SUCCESS (0) is returned, otherwise a negative error value. REPORTING BUGS
